SOCIAL ISOLATION AMONG AFRICAN AMERICAN AND BLACK OLDER ADULTS

Social isolation and loneliness are alarmingly common among African American and Black older adults, particularly now during the COVID-19 national health crisis. In cities across the nation, African American and Black older adults are more likely to live in communities that are geographically and economically isolated from the economic opportunities, services and institutions that they need …
